The Borla 140797BC ATAK Cat-Back is tuned for sound and performance specifically for the 5.3L engine in the Silverado and Sierra 1500. For the owner who is looking for an aggressive and head-turning sound, we recommend our ATAK system. It provides a drastic difference in tone and overall volume from the much quieter stock exhaust system while maintaining a drone-free driving experience inside the vehicle. This Cat-Back system features a dual side exit with round rolled tips in a black chrome finish on T-304 stainless steel and bolts on to the factory exhaust for ease of installation. Using Borla Stainless Steel Polish p# 21461 is NOT recommended with these black chrome tips. We suggest cleaning the tips with hot water and a microfiber cloth. Each system is built from premium, high-quality T-304 austenitic stainless steel, superior to T-400 series knockoffs (such as 409), to give you the absolute best in performance and durability. Ultra-smooth mandrel bends ensure maximum flow & power, and precision computer-controlled CNC manufacturing ensures an accurate fit. You can count on Borla to provide durability, performance, sound, and a Million-Mile Warranty. See separate note about warranty on tip finish.
